Media Advisory
The National Institutes of Health (NIH) will host researchers from the Telomere-to-Telomere (T2T) consortium, who have now sequenced the remaining 8% of DNA that was unable to be sequenced by the Human Genome Project and has eluded researchers for nearly two decades.

Educational Resources
Cloning is the process of making identical copies of an organism, cell, or DNA sequence.
